完善资料让更多小伙伴认识你,还能领取20积分哦, 立即完善>
首先来了解 ARM 体系结构中的字长。 字(Word),在 ARM 体系结构中,字的长度为 32 位,而在 8 位/16 位处理器体系结构中,字的长度一般为 16 位。 半字(Half Word),在 ARM 体系结构中,半字的长度为 16 位,与 8 位/16 位处理器 体系结构中字的长度一致。 字节(Byte),在 ARM 体系结构和 8 位/16 位处理器体系结构中,字节的长度均为 8 位。 指令长度可以是 32 位(ARM 状态下),也可以为 16 位(Thumb 状态下)。 ARM920T 中支持字节(8 位)、半字(16 位)、字(32 位)3 种数据类型,其中,字需 要 4 字节对齐,半字需要 2 字节对齐。 ARM920T 体系结构将存储器看成是从零地址开始的字节的线性组合。从 0字节到 3字节放 置第 1个存储的字数据,从第 4个字节到第 7个字节放置第 2个存储的字数据,依次排列。 作为 32 位的微处理器,ARM920T 体系结构所支持的最大寻址空间位 4GB(232字节) 。 ARM920T 体系结构支持两种方法存储字数据,即大端(Big Enddian)格式和小端(Little Enddian)格式。在大端格式中,字数据的高字节存储在低字节单元中,而字数据的低字节则 存放在高地址单元中,如图 1-1 所示。 ![]() |
|
相关推荐 |
|
你正在撰写讨论
如果你是对讨论或其他讨论精选点评或询问,请使用“评论”功能。
2205 浏览 0 评论
快速部署!米尔全志T527开发板的OpenCV行人检测方案指南
9906 浏览 0 评论
3182 浏览 0 评论
边缘设备的奇妙之旅:在小凌派-RK2206上部署AI模型来实现视觉巡线
1567 浏览 0 评论
6120 浏览 0 评论
小黑屋| 手机版| Archiver| 电子发烧友 ( 湘ICP备2023018690号 )
GMT+8, 2025-6-15 15:08 , Processed in 0.368977 second(s), Total 35, Slave 28 queries .
Powered by 电子发烧友网
© 2015 bbs.elecfans.com
关注我们的微信
下载发烧友APP
电子发烧友观察
版权所有 © 湖南华秋数字科技有限公司
电子发烧友 (电路图) 湘公网安备 43011202000918 号 电信与信息服务业务经营许可证:合字B2-20210191